http://www.scopeinternational.com.cn/codemarathon/samplePractice.action

能打开链接的话,那就看,不能的话,看下面。

由于国内两大网络(电信和网通)之间的互联互通问题,使得电信用户访问网通机房或者网通用户访问电信机房都无法获得满意的访问速度。为了解决这个问题,国内大型网站都在两个网络内部署有对应的服务器。你现在所做的是前端加速产品,这个产品可以根据用户的访问IP,以及用户的访问目的地,导向对应的DNS服务器。

比如,存在配置表(配置表可多达2000-5000万条记录):

58.16.0.0-58.16.255.255 mail.google.com name-server-1

58.16.0.0-58.16.255.255 weibo.com name-server-2

那么对于某用户,ip地址为,58.16.128.1,访问目的地为mail.google.com,则应该返回DNS服务器name-server-1。要求该产品每秒能处理不小于1000个请求。请设计对应的方案。

2013渣打科营编程马拉松赛样题相关推荐

  1. 2013渣打科营编程马拉松赛 初始题目

    /** * 用java编写,写的比较乱,没有体现面向对象,哈哈,结果是对的.欢迎评论! * **/ 题目:https://github.com/aqingsao/length/blob/master ...

  2. 首届渣打科营编程马拉松赛初赛圆满结束

    本文讲的是首届渣打科营编程马拉松赛初赛圆满结束,首届渣打科营编程马拉松赛初赛于8月31日至9月8日圆满举行,初赛分为天津赛区.北京赛区.上海赛区和成都赛区四场.本届大赛以"Code to C ...

  3. 渣打科营编程马拉松赛后总结

    比赛终于在各种插曲之中结束了,最终获得了一个什么最佳技术创新奖.说兴奋确实挺兴奋的,感谢狗哥和师弟.说遗憾也是挺遗憾的,感觉一开始可以夺冠的,但是之间的一些问题最终变成了这个结果.赛后的回学校的路上, ...

  4. 渣打科营中心:金融市场的三大挑战

    本文讲的是渣打科营中心:金融市场的三大挑战,近日,以"Code to Change --编程美好生活"为主题的首届渣打编程马拉松赛于天津经济技术开发区圆满落幕.本届渣打编程马拉松赛 ...

  5. 挑战 渣打科营“Mini Code Marathon”赛题:连通块最少

    package csdn; /** * 渣打科营"Mini Code Marathon"赛题:连通块最少 * @author Cheeps * 思路:在同一个全1连通块中,任何两个 ...

  6. 渣打科营 Mini Code Marathon

    代码如下,据说格式错误,nnd #include <stdio.h> #include <string.h></

  7. 关于对渣打编程马拉松 2013 的样题的一些想法

    原题: 各位参赛选手, 以下是2013渣打科营编程马拉松大赛的样题.样题题型及难易程度仅供参考. 由于国内两大网络(电信和网通)之间的互联互通问题,使得电信用户访问网通机房或者网通用户访问电信机房都无 ...

  8. 决战泰达:渣打编程马拉松赛圆满落幕

    本文讲的是决战泰达:渣打编程马拉松赛圆满落幕,2013年10月27日消息,以"Code to Change --编程美好生活"为主题的首届渣打编程马拉松赛于天津经济技术开发区圆满落 ...

  9. 记渣打银行科营中心的面试

    周六去天津渣打银行科营中心面试,现在来说说自己从这次面试得到的体会. 首先声明:我是一名大四学生,从学校投简历然后经过电话面试,英文电话面试通过了,然后来参加的笔试和面试. 整个面试流程是这样的: 一 ...

最新文章

  1. 腐蚀rust高速箭怎么做不了_皮带轮动平衡怎么做
  2. 无人车时代:用深度学习辅助行人检测
  3. 【深度学习】图解 9 种PyTorch中常用的学习率调整策略
  4. java 微信jssdk签名_JAVA生成微信JSSDK接口签名
  5. 曾鸣:未来十年,将确定智能商业的格局|干货
  6. 面向对象 (接口 Interface)
  7. Mark Cuban投资组合中60%为BTC,30%为ETH
  8. Linux C入门之路,Linux C++学习之路
  9. Python+OpenCV:直方图(Histograms)
  10. C语言和C++的区别到底是什么?
  11. 算法学习之路|反转链表
  12. filepath直接指定到文件名吗_Bash技巧:介绍一个批量复制文件到指定目录的Shell脚本...
  13. 将图片放大如何保持图片的清晰度?
  14. 风景日历java制作_风景日历制作系统
  15. 基于中移物联网MQTT协议的ESP8266远程开机实例
  16. 多租户:防止意外创建可插拔数据库(PDB)- Lone-PDB
  17. gitweb 搭建教程
  18. Spring boot如何集成Redis(四)
  19. 微信支付SDK(python版)
  20. 1、MySQL——MySQL数据库管理系统、数据库基本概念

热门文章

  1. 未来的网页网页设计趋势
  2. 微信小程序“真心话”冲刺阶段01
  3. c语言方阵编程,C语言编程蛇形方阵问题
  4. 云笔记的项目分析(5):个人中心:验证昵称的唯一性
  5. Java学习路线【转载自topinking老兄的博客】
  6. Linux那些事儿之我是U盘(49)跟着感觉走(一)
  7. Java代理模式汇编
  8. Jumpserver-堡垒机
  9. Win10桌面图标怎么显示“我的电脑“,“网络“,“我的文档“,“控制面板“图标
  10. 英语口语/高级口语——话题vs备考资料